The Role of Spinal Surgery in Treating Scoliosis

Scoliosis, a condition characterized by an abnormal curvature of the spine, affects millions of individuals worldwide. For some patients, particularly those with severe spinal deformities, spinal surgery may be the most effective treatment option. Understanding the role of spinal surgery in treating scoliosis can provide clarity for patients exploring their options.

Spinal surgery for scoliosis typically comes into play when non-surgical treatments, such as bracing and physical therapy, fail to halt the progression of the curve. The decision to proceed with surgery often hinges on the degree of curvature, the age of the patient, and whether the curve is causing significant pain or complications.

One of the primary surgical procedures performed for scoliosis is spinal fusion. This involves connecting two or more vertebrae together to stabilize the spine and reduce curvature. Surgeons often use bone grafts, metal rods, and screws to support the spine during the healing process. Through spinal fusion, not only can the curvature be corrected to some extent, but it can also prevent further progression as the patient matures.

Another approach is vertebral body tethering, an innovative technique that uses a flexible cord to correct spinal alignment in growing adolescents. This less invasive method can allow for growth while simultaneously correcting the curve, minimizing the need for more invasive surgery later in life.

It’s essential to have thorough discussions with orthopedic specialists about the potential risks and benefits of surgical intervention. Potential complications may include infection, bleeding, and the possibility of additional surgeries in the future. However, many patients report a significant improvement in quality of life post-surgery, including reductions in pain and enhanced mobility.

Post-operative rehabilitation is a critical aspect of spinal surgery for scoliosis. Patients typically engage in physical therapy aimed at strengthening the back muscles and improving flexibility. This not only supports recovery but also reinforces the newly aligned spine.

Monitoring and follow-up care are essential. Regular check-ups can help assess the success of the surgery and the overall health of the spine. Physicians may recommend X-rays to track spinal alignment, particularly in younger patients whose spines continue to grow.
